Cream Cheese Filled Cookies

Ingredients

  • Cookie
  • 1/3 cup butter, softened
  • 1/3 cup shortening
  • 3/4 cup sugar
  • 1 egg
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1-3/4 cups all purpose flour
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• Filling
  • 2 pkg (3 oz each) cream cheese, softened
  • 1-1/2 cups confectioner's sugar
  • 2 tbsp all purpose flour
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 drop yellow food color, optional
  • Topping
  • 3/4 cup semisweet chocolate chips
  • 3 tbsp butter

Preparation

Step 1

1. In a large mixing bowl, cream butter, shortening and sugar. Beat in egg and vanilla. Combine flour, baking powder and salt; gradually add ot the creamed mixture. Shape into two 12" rolls: wrap each in plastic wrap. Refrigerate for at least 4 hours or overnight.
2. Unwrap and cut into 1" slices. Place 1 in. apart on greased baking sheet. Bake at 375 degrees F for 10-12 mintues or until lightly browned. Immediately make an indentation in the center of each cookie using the end of a wooden spoon handle. Remove to wire rack to cool.
3. In a mixing bowl, combine the filling ingredients; mix well. Place 2 teaspoons in the center of each cookie. Let stand until set. In a heavy saucepan or microwave, melt chocolate chips and butter; stir until smooth. Drizzle over each cookie.
